Choosing poster easel stands by easel type
Start with the easel type because it shapes placement and viewing height. Tripod styles open quickly, while floor models create a steady presentation stand for larger displays.
Tabletop versions work well on reception desks, conference tables, and classroom counters. A-frame and display stand designs fit entryways, aisles, and directional sign placement.
Each format supports a different traffic pattern. Tripod and floor options suit presentations, while tabletop and A-frame styles support check-in areas and compact display zones.
What to look for in board compatibility
Board compatibility matters because not every easel fits every display material the same way. Check whether the model supports poster board, foam board, presentation board, or sign board thickness.
An easel for poster board should hold edges securely without hiding important text or graphics. A posterboard easel also needs enough base stability for taller boards.
Foam board displays often need balanced support points and a wide stance. Presentation boards may need extra height and clear sight lines during meetings or classroom talks.

Understanding adjustability on a presentation easel
Adjustability affects viewing comfort and display flexibility. A presentation easel with telescoping legs or adjustable height can fit seated meetings, standing presentations, or entry displays.
Fixed height models keep setup simple and consistent across repeated uses. Multi-angle support helps position reflective boards and printed signs for easier reading under indoor lighting.
Poster easel stands with adjustable settings can handle different board sizes more easily. That makes them practical for switching from a single poster to a larger presentation board.

How to choose the right combination
Compare your space first, then measure the board you'll use most often. After that, check whether you need tabletop or floor height, fixed or adjustable support, and foldable storage.
If your display changes often, look for flexible sizing and easy transport. If your setup stays in one place, focus on footprint, board grip, and a polished presentation easel look.
